Its now Friday and I have been in Buenos Aires for one week but have been swept up in this world of CITA. Classes start at around 12 each day and end at 7.30pm then there is usually a performance at 11 or 12 and a milonga until 4am.
There are may hot bods in stretchy pants around here and a clear pecking order of hot young porteņo dancers at the top and middle aged americanos at the bottom. The stakes are high to get as much out of this experience as possible by teaming up with another dancer who is as good and hopefully better than you. As you can imagine this equation will at best only produce 50 percent satisfaction.
This is where the "taxi dancer" cames in to fulfill the unfulfilled. There are certified CITA taxi dancers for hire at the office and they are skimmed from the upper eschelons of the pecking order. they are experienced but not expert dancers though this makes very little difference to the middle aged americano/a who hires them. CITA must pay the dancer a cut of the 45 pesos ($15USD) it costs and the dancer also gets a free
